    I bought these for a set of Porsche wheels that I wanted to run on my BMW E39, but ended up going with another set of wheels. THESE ARE BRAND NEW, purchased from Motorsport for $325. Only opened and used for test fitment, literally 0 miles on them. Unfortunately since these are built to order, they do not accommodate returns, so Im trying to make some of my money back.

    Here are the specs:

    5x120mm (5x4.75) TO 5x130mm adapters

    Hub side bore is 74.1mm, and wheel side bore is 73mm
    I ordered these to be able to run on e39's, you can easily use these for all other BMW's with the 72.56mm hub with hubcentric rings.

    2x 42mm
    2x 20mm

    Inlcuded are 20 bolts
